A Personal Look at Medical Assistance in Dying

On June 17, 2016, medical assistance in dying (MAID) became a legal option in Canada for the first time. This milestone was realized more than 20 years after Sue Rodrigues, a B.C. woman living with ALS, challenged Canada’s Criminal Code prohibition on assisted suicide under the Canadian Charter of Rights and Freedoms.
